1. Defining the Phillip Lim Style: A Study in Understated Elegance
Phillip Lim's designs are synonymous with "effortless chic." But what does that actually mean? It's more than just comfortable clothes; it's a carefully curated balance of sophisticated silhouettes, luxurious fabrics, and unexpected details. The core of the Phillip Lim style lies in its commitment to wearability and timelessness. Think clean lines, refined tailoring, and a muted color palette punctuated by subtle pops of color or texture.
- Key Characteristics:
- Clean Lines & Modern Silhouettes: Favoring architectural shapes and minimalist designs.
- Luxurious Fabrics: Utilizing high-quality materials like silk, cashmere, and supple leather.
- Understated Color Palette: Primarily neutral tones (black, white, gray, navy, beige) with occasional vibrant accents.
- Focus on Comfort & Functionality: Garments designed for everyday wear, with an emphasis on ease of movement.
- Unexpected Details: Unique embellishments, asymmetrical cuts, or subtle hardware that elevates the design.
- Effortless Layering: Encouraging the mixing and matching of different textures and pieces to create a personalized look.
- Versatility: Pieces that can be dressed up or down, making them suitable for a variety of occasions.
2. Building a Phillip Lim Style Wardrobe: Essential Pieces to Invest In
Creating a wardrobe that embodies the Phillip Lim aesthetic is about investing in versatile, high-quality pieces that can be mixed and matched to create a multitude of outfits. Here are some essential items to consider:
-
The Perfect Blazer: A well-tailored blazer is a cornerstone of the Phillip Lim style. Opt for a classic black, navy, or gray blazer in a high-quality fabric like wool or crepe. This piece can be dressed up with tailored trousers and heels or dressed down with jeans and sneakers. -
The Silk Blouse: A luxurious silk blouse adds a touch of elegance to any outfit. Choose a neutral color like white, cream, or black, or opt for a subtle print like a delicate floral or geometric pattern.
-
Wide-Leg Trousers: Wide-leg trousers are a chic and comfortable alternative to skinny jeans or leggings. Look for trousers in a flowing fabric like silk or linen, and pair them with a fitted top or a tucked-in blouse. -
The Little Black Dress (LBD): A classic LBD is a timeless wardrobe staple, and the Phillip Lim version is typically sleek and minimalist. Look for a dress with clean lines and a flattering silhouette.
-
The Leather Jacket: A leather jacket adds a touch of edge to any outfit. Choose a classic biker jacket or a more refined leather jacket with clean lines.
-
Minimalist Knitwear: Cashmere sweaters, merino wool cardigans, and simple knit dresses are essential for creating a cozy and chic look.
-
Statement Shoes: While the Phillip Lim style is generally understated, statement shoes can add a touch of personality to your outfit. Consider investing in a pair of sleek ankle boots, pointed-toe heels, or chunky sneakers.
3. Accessorizing the Phillip Lim Style: Less is More
When it comes to accessories, the Phillip Lim style embraces a "less is more" approach. Focus on quality over quantity, and choose pieces that complement your outfit without overwhelming it.
-
Minimalist Jewelry: Delicate necklaces, simple earrings, and understated rings are the perfect finishing touch.
-
Structured Handbags: A structured handbag in a neutral color is a chic and practical accessory.
-
Scarves: A silk scarf can add a pop of color or texture to your outfit.
-
Belts: A belt can help to define your waist and add structure to your look.
-
Sunglasses: Classic sunglasses are a must-have for protecting your eyes and adding a touch of cool to your outfit.
